Number 52 is a beautiful Georgian Townhouse in the centre of Helston. The room was very clean, well maintained and comfortable with ensuite bathroom. The buffet breakfast was excellent. Although it is next door to the wonderful Blue Anchor Pub, it was not too noisy, however there is some road noise as it is situated on the main street and with a taxi rank outside. We were very impressed and would stay there again. It is very good value for money particularly as there is no extra charge for a dog.

Checkin is remote.. As in there is no one at the property. Would not be a problem normally... however the fire alarm activated at 1.30am. There was no evac plan. No contact details and no way to turn off the alarm. It was through the kindness of strangers and the fire service that the owner was eventually found and someone was sent to deactivate the alarm. Parking is a problem as others have said and noise definatly a issue when next doors pub has live music..and all rooms have thin walls.
